Duchesne County, Utah Property Taxes
Median Duchesne County effective property tax rate: 0.71%, significantly lower than the national median of 1.02%.
Median Duchesne County home value: $135,694
Median annual Duchesne County tax bill: $804, $1,596 lower than the national median property tax bill of $2,400.
How are property taxes in Duchesne County calculated?
Property taxes in Duchesne County are calculated based on the tax assessed value, which is often lower than the actual market value due to property tax exemptions such as the homestead or senior exemption.

Property Tax Rates Across Duchesne County, Utah
Local government entities set tax rates, which can vary widely within a state. The reason for this variation is that annually, each county estimates its required budget to provide essential services and divides that by the total value of all taxable property within its jurisdiction. This calculation results in the property tax rate. While there are votes and laws involved in setting tax rates and budgets, in a nutshell, this is the annual process.
